Alexandra Cooper was a daughter born to Bryan Cooper and Laurie Cooper on August 21 the 21st of August, 1995 in Newtown Pennsylvania. Her father played hockey who played at the University of Wisconsin. Boston University noticed Cooper's athleticism. They offered a athletic scholarship. Cooper took an offer of a Boston University scholarship offer, played soccer with Boston University Division-1's Women's Team during her degree. She also served as co-captain in her senior season. Cooper assisted her team to win four M.C.T. In her four seasons, she took home Prep A and was awarded the honor of the All-Prep First Team. Her junior and senior year honors included All-Prep, All-Area and All-Prep 1st Team. Cooper was a multi-talented athlete, but sports were just one. Through her college years, she became fascinated with the entertainment and media world. She decided this is the path for her. She graduated with a bachelor's degree in TV and Film from Boston University.
